Effects Of Round-Up On The Environment, Sandra J. Marcu
Effects Of Round-Up On The Environment, Sandra J. Marcu
Journal of Earth and Life Science
Many people around the world have used and still currently use Roundup but are unaware of the effects it has on the environment. Roundup is a spray on application weedkiller that is widely used around the world today both residentially and commercially. It enables its user to grow a garden or a field of crops with a no-tilling approach to eliminate weeds. It is a well-known and popular choice for killing weeds that has been around since the mid 1970’s (Oca, 2017). The Role Of The Social Network In Adopting New Turfgrass Varieties: An Analysis Of Twitter Data, Joohun Han, Chanjin Chung, Yanqi Wu
The Role Of The Social Network In Adopting New Turfgrass Varieties: An Analysis Of Twitter Data, Joohun Han, Chanjin Chung, Yanqi Wu
Agricultural Economics and Agribusiness Faculty Publications and Presentations
This study examines the effect of social learning on new turfgrass variety adoption decisions using data from 231 turfgrass professionals’ Twitter accounts between 1 Jun 2018 and 31 Dec 2019. To determine the social learning effect, we decompose networking effects into social learning, individual-level and group-level similarities, herd behavior, and clustering effects. Our study estimates a spatial autoregressive probit model that directly incorporates the social network structure to account for unobservable networking effects and potential reflection problem. Stream Restoration Effectiveness In Mullins Creek In Fayetteville, Arkansas, Amadeo Scott, Shannon Speir
Stream Restoration Effectiveness In Mullins Creek In Fayetteville, Arkansas, Amadeo Scott, Shannon Speir
Discovery, The Student Journal of Dale Bumpers College of Agricultural, Food and Life Sciences
Lotic waterways are vital for habitat, food, water, and flood protection, but urbanization poses a major threat to their integrity. Runoff from urban surfaces leads to pollution, flashiness, loss of biodiversity, and other symptoms, also known as Urban Stream Syndrome (USS). Streams can be restored in order to combat USS, but most restorations are not monitored, so their long-term effectiveness is unknown. This study quantitatively evaluated a decade-old stream restoration in Fayetteville, Arkansas, to assess its effectiveness in combating USS and achieving set restoration goals, and to gain insights for future restoration projects. Evaluating Efficiency And Accuracy Of Three Texture Analysis Methods For Blackberry Fruit, Rhys M. Brock, Carmen Johns, Katelyn Lust-Moore, Margaret Worthington
Evaluating Efficiency And Accuracy Of Three Texture Analysis Methods For Blackberry Fruit, Rhys M. Brock, Carmen Johns, Katelyn Lust-Moore, Margaret Worthington
Discovery, The Student Journal of Dale Bumpers College of Agricultural, Food and Life Sciences
A major objective of the University of Arkansas System Division of Agriculture (UADA) Fruit Breeding program is to improve the texture of blackberry (Rubus subgenus Rubus Watson). Blackberry varieties with improved fruit firmness transport and store well and may maintain superior quality under challenging postharvest conditions than softer varieties. Increased firmness may also make cultivars less susceptible to red drupelet reversion (RDR), a postharvest disorder of blackberries in which fully black drupelets revert to red after harvest. Effect Of Nanobubble-Oxygenated Water For Irrigation Of Sand-Based Golf Course Putting Greens, Eric Deboer
Effect Of Nanobubble-Oxygenated Water For Irrigation Of Sand-Based Golf Course Putting Greens, Eric Deboer
Graduate Theses and Dissertations
Nanobubbles (NBs) are sub-micron, stable cavities of gas. The properties of NBs theoretically allow long bubble residence times and high gas dissolution rates resulting in the supersaturation of oxygen in water. Adequate soil aeration is a constant concern for producers of agricultural and horticultural crops. Because of their unique properties, NBs have been investigated for oxygenating water used in the irrigation of various agricultural and horticultural crops to increase soil oxygen concentration. Rice Biomass Response To Various Phosphorus Fertilizers In A Phosphorus-Deficient Soil Under Simulated Furrow-Irrigation, Jonathan B. Brye, Kristofor R. Brye, Diego Della Lunga
Rice Biomass Response To Various Phosphorus Fertilizers In A Phosphorus-Deficient Soil Under Simulated Furrow-Irrigation, Jonathan B. Brye, Kristofor R. Brye, Diego Della Lunga
Discovery, The Student Journal of Dale Bumpers College of Agricultural, Food and Life Sciences
Wastewater-recovered phosphorus (P), in the form of the mineral struvite (MgNH4PO4∙6H2O), may provide a sustainable alternative to decreasing rock-phosphate reserves. Struvite can be generated via precipitation methods, potentially reducing the amount of P runoff to aquatic ecosystems. The objective of this greenhouse tub study was to evaluate the effects of chemically and electrochemically precipitated struvite (CPST and ECST, respectively) on aboveground plant response in a hybrid rice cultivar grown using furrow-irrigation compared to other common fertilizer-P sources [i.e., triple super phosphate (TSP) and diammonium phosphate (DAP)] using three replications of fertilizer treatment in a P-deficient silt loam (Typic Glossaqualfs). Temporal, Phenotypic, And Quantitative Characterization Of Thyroid Infiltrating Mononuclear Cells During Development Of Spontaneous Autoimmune Thyroiditis In Obese Strain Chickens, Katelyn M. Clark, Chrysta N. Beck, Gisela F. Erf
Temporal, Phenotypic, And Quantitative Characterization Of Thyroid Infiltrating Mononuclear Cells During Development Of Spontaneous Autoimmune Thyroiditis In Obese Strain Chickens, Katelyn M. Clark, Chrysta N. Beck, Gisela F. Erf
Discovery, The Student Journal of Dale Bumpers College of Agricultural, Food and Life Sciences
The Obese strain (OS) of chickens spontaneously develops autoimmune thyroiditis (SAT) and is a well-established biomedical model for Hashimoto’s thyroiditis in humans. Both conditions are characterized by the infiltration of thyroid glands with mononuclear immune cells resulting in the destruction of thyroid tissue and impairment of the thyroid’s endocrinological functions. Past studies described immune cell infiltration in thyroids of the OS chickens, but the time-course, cell composition, and relative amounts of the various immune cells infiltrating the thyroids have not been well defined.
